Ticonderoga's Treasures of 1776

Step beyond the galleries for a rare, Curator-led experience at Fort Ticonderoga’s Thompson-Pell Research Center. Come face-to-face with original artifacts from this critical year of the Revolutionary War. Explore the dramatic moments and larger-than-life personalities connected to Ticonderoga, including Benedict Arnold, Horatio Gates, and Anthony Wayne. This behind-the-scenes tour brings the decisions, tensions, and turning points of the war to life through the actual objects and documents that were there 250 years ago.

This specialty program is limited to 15 participants and takes place about a mile from the main historic site of Fort Ticonderoga.

Time & Location: Located at the Thompson-Pell Research Center, 30 Fort Ti Rd., begins at 3pm, doors open at 2:45pm
Length: 90 minutes
